Supporting the Wealth Management division and working primarily in the Highland Park office, this individual will report directly to the Chief Operating Officer and assist with day-to-day regulatory compliance responsibilities relating to required daily supervision of all Wealth Advisor teams. Tasks include new accounts approvals, trade execution monitoring, advertising review and internal reviews/inquiries.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for oversight and supervision across the entire Wealth Management division
  • Reviewing new account paperwork and other standard account requests for suitability, appropriateness and completeness, and providing supervisory Principal approval for processing.
  • Developing procedures and working guides for operational processes, including paperwork requirements, for Wealth Advisors to utilize as a reference
  • Monitoring and reviewing daily trading activity
  • Reviewing pre-trade and post-trade compliance exception reporting, inquiring where appropriate, and maintaining evidence of such review
  • Reviewing email correspondence for conflicts of interest or prohibited behavior
  • Acting as liaison to Middle Office to ensure efficiencies, working to improve operational procedures
  • Maintaining working knowledge of Fidelity (NFS) and Schwab policies affecting Wealth Advisors workflow and communicating such policies to the Wealth Advisors business
  • Corresponding and collaborating with Legal/Compliance Department members regarding various compliance inquiries, including AML, suitability, and other compliance issues
  • Reviewing and providing pre-approval for employee personal financial transactions, working to identify any conflicts of interest
  • Reviewing advertising and client presentation material for compliance with applicable rules and regulations
